The short point involved in this case is whether the service tax paid by the appellant on maintenance of garden inside the factory premises can be allowed as Cenvat credit under Cenvat Credit Rules, 2004. The Revenue was of the view that gardening has got no nexus with manufacturing activity and therefore credit has been denied in the proceed....
